My mails to Al have been bouncing recently, so I do not have his ack but the uaccess change is of the trivial / obviously correct variety. The address_space_operations fixes a regression. * A filesystem-dax fix to correct the zero page lookup to be compatible with non-x86 (mips and s390) architectures. Arguably only the address_space_operations fix is urgent for -rc6, the others can reasonably wait, but I see no reason to hold them back. This has all appeared in -next with no reported issues.
